    Abstract: Disclosed is a method of conditioning one or more parametric models. The method comprises obtaining a plurality of candidate parametric models, each describing a sequence of domains characterising a subsurface region and determining whether each sequence of domains described by one or more of said candidate parametric models is a valid sequence of domains. For each valid sequence of domains, each candidate parametric model describing that valid sequence of domains (or a subset of these models) is conditioned simultaneously, for example by using an Ensemble Kalman Filter or artificial neural network.

    Abstract: A host devices transfers client data from a client device to the host device. The host device generates sort keys for host data that includes the client data. The host device sorts the host data using the sort keys and transfers the sorted host data to the client device. The client data and host data may include music, video, or other content.

    Abstract: A rocket motor case includes a plurality of plank sections which provide a structural key for locking metal and/or composite end enclosures in place as part of the motor case. The plank sections are sized longitudinally to form venting spaces in the motor case sidewall to allow passive venting in the event of propellant ignition during cook-off. The plank sections have plank legs which are surrounded by tailorable roll-bonded sheet material to complete formation of the motor case sidewall.

    Abstract: The apparatus and method herein provide a means for actively monitoring a communications node for datapath disruptions caused within the node. It was developed to address linecard failures that were detected in the field and for which traditional error detection mechanisms such as CRC and OAM CC checks are not feasible. According to one implementation, statistics are collected over a preset time interval. If any egress cell counts are zero over a full interval, then the ingress interface for that datapath is determined, e.g. using the node's cross-datapath information, and the corresponding linecard of that ingress interface is contacted to determine the ingress cell count. If the ingress cell count is non-zero then the datapath is alarmed since the complete lack of cells transmitted at the egress indicates a datapath disruption.

    Abstract: Apparatus and methods for autonomously identifying and mitigating soft-errors affecting integrated circuit memory storage devices are provided. A soft-error mitigation process is invoked upon finding that an integrated circuit memory device is affected by a parity error. In a staged approach, unused memory regions of the integrated circuit memory device are reinitialized; if a redundant deployment prevails, the subsystem corresponding to the affected integrated circuit memory device is reset; memory regions having copies of contents thereof stored at remote locations are rewritten with obtained copies of the contents; and memory regions storing contents which are generated at run-time are reinitialized. Directed parity error scans are employed at each stage. If the parity error persists, one of the apparatus, and the subsystem corresponding to the affected silicon memory device is reset during a maintenance window.

    Abstract: Methods for separating, in a continuous, multizone fluid medium, cells, particles, or other molecules of interest (MOI) from associated or contaminating unwanted materials not of interest (MNOI). The invention involves forced movement of MOI into certain zones having properties which deter the entry of unwanted materials. Differential movement of MOI and MNOI occurs by active counterforces that move MNOI but not MOI. MOI are tagged with magnetic particles and moved with a magnetic field through a fluid, or zones, of higher specific gravity that prevents, by flotation counterforce, unwanted less dense materials from entering. Surfaces specifically coated with reactants are reactive with the MOI in the tagged magnetic particle complex and of buoyant or other forces are used to remove any unbound material from the surface before reading.

    Abstract: Magnets and magnetic particle-labeled reagents are used to capture and/or release magnetic particle-tagged entities for immunohematology diagnostic testing purposes, especially tests performed in blood banking. The magnetic tagged entities may be tagged antibodies, tagged blood cells, tagged universal binding partners, especially tagged lectins and tagged Coombs reagent, and other binding agents such as biotin-avidin, Protein A or G, ligands and their receptors and the like. Separation of unbound material from bound material is effected through the use of one or both the magnetic field effect on the magnetic labeled reactants and the density gradients of layers of an assay construct. Constructs such as chromatographic strip lateral flow format, and liquid phase reactions in suitable vessels with end point determinations that do not require centrifugation to detect reacted entities.

    Abstract: Radial block copolymers are mechanically combined with additional polymeric materials to form plastic compositions having a high degree of clarity so that they can be substituted for polyvinylchloride plastic compositions in the fabrication of such devices as intravenous and blood tubing, containers for intravenous solutions and blood fractions, functional parts of intravenous administration equipment such as sight and drip chambers, needle adapters and miscellaneous assemblies for contact with intravenous fluids. The compounds of this invention can also be utilized for catherization, bodily drainage systems, and as pharmaceutical closures, resealable injection sites and syringe plunger tips.

    Abstract: Radial block copolymers are blended with additional polymeric materials to form rubber-like plastic compositions having high elastic and reseal properties so that they can be utilized as a rubber replacement in the fabrication of resealable injecton sites in intravenous administration equipment and stoppers for containers where resealability after puncture is also a desirable property.
